Romans 4:19
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
Without weakening in his faith, he faced the fact that his body was as good as dead—since he was about a hundred years old—and that Sarah's womb was also dead.
Romans 4:20
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
Yet he did not waver through unbelief regarding the promise of God, but was strengthened in his faith and gave glory to God,
Romans 4:21
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
being fully persuaded that God had power to do what he had promised.
Romans 4:22
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
This is why "it was credited to him as righteousness."
Romans 4:23
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
The words "it was credited to him" were written not for him alone,
Romans 4:24
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
but also for us, to whom God will credit righteousness—for us who believe in him who raised Jesus our Lord from the dead.
Romans 4:25
[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
He was delivered over to death for our sins and was raised to life for our justification.
